Handover note — Vexbin scanner integration

To whoever picks this up from me: the Lanternware barcode scanner bridge is live in the Torsey warehouse but not yet in Aldmere. Known quirk: duplicate scans within 200ms are dropped by design, so tell customers that rapid re-scans are expected to no-op. Firmware pairing is handled by the Vexbin daemon, not the app. Support should triage against the settings below. The daemon currently runs with these values.

config for kafof-bawef:
holath:
  log_level: debug
  metrics_host: metrics.holath.qorvelsys.internal
  pin: 2191
  pool_size: 32

TURN-208: Gatevale turnstile counters at the Merrow Field pilot double-count when a rotation reverses mid-cycle. Attendance totals drift roughly 2% high per event. The debounce window fix is implemented, reviewed by Ilsa, and soak-tested across two simulated match days without drift. Ready for your cut; the candidate build is identified below.

trace token, tagag-tafog: htk6_5ed18c

**Q: What gates a canary deploy in Fernbrook?**

A: Canaries on the Ostler platform must pass three gates: error-rate delta under 0.5% versus baseline, p99 latency within 10%, and zero failed auth probes. Gates evaluate over a 20-minute window; any breach triggers automatic rollback. Overrides require two approvers from the Ostler release group and are logged. To access the override console during an incident, enter the recovery passphrase below.

vault phrase of bagaf-kajeg = jorath-feniel-briir-siliel-ralix

All conversion paths must use the fixed-point money type in libcoin, with rounding applied once, at the final step, using banker's rounding. Future maintainers: do not introduce float arithmetic anywhere in the settlement pipeline, even in tests, as test fixtures have leaked into production logic before. The rounding policy and audited examples are documented on the internal page below.

runbook for badug-kadup: https://confluence.zemvarlabs.internal/projects/browse/display/projects/bd1b